This easy Kool-Aid cake or cupcake recipe is delicious, and the best part is you can use any flavor you like.

You can choose colors or flavors to match a holiday, season, or personal preference. Think of it like adding pudding mix to a cake batter — simple and effective.
The fun is experimenting with different flavor combinations. You can layer cakes, add a flavored center, or top a cake with a contrasting Kool-Aid frosting. The process takes about the same time as making any standard boxed cake or cupcakes.

Ingredients
For the Cake:
- 1 pkg. 2-layer size white or yellow cake mix
- 0.15 ounce Kool-Aid (any flavor unsweetened drink mix)
For the Frosting:
- 16 ounce white frosting (complementary flavor)
- 0.15 ounce Kool-Aid (any flavor unsweetened drink mix)
Instructions
-
Prepare the cake mix according to the directions on the box.
-
When you are ready to beat the batter, add the Kool-Aid packet (0.15 oz) and mix until fully incorporated.
-
Bake as directed on the cake mix box.
-
Allow the cake or cupcakes to cool completely before frosting.
-
For Kool-Aid frosting, buy white icing and stir one 0.15 oz packet of Kool-Aid unsweetened drink mix into the entire canister. Mix thoroughly, then frost.
